Bridging the Gap: Computer Science & Mental Wellbeing Applications
The field of computer science has tremendous potential to address growing concerns about mental wellbeing. Harnessing the power of data analysis, artificial intelligence, and digital tools, researchers are exploring novel applications that can track mental health signals, offer personalized therapy, and boost overall wellbeing.
- One promising area is the development of digital applications that provide mindfulness exercises, anxiety reduction, and guided meditations.
- Another avenue involves leveraging machine learning to recognize patterns in online activity that may suggest mental health challenges.
- This technology-based approach has the potential to revolutionize how we understand mental wellbeing, making it more affordable to a wider group.
Women's Mental Health: Navigating a Complex Landscape
Women face distinct challenges when it comes to their mental health. Societal pressures can be overwhelming, leading to feelings of anxiety. , Moreover, women are often limited from asking for help due to societal perceptions. It's vital that we create a understanding environment where women feel comfortable to discuss their mental health issues without shame.
This demands a multi-faceted plan that encompasses prevention, early intervention, and access to quality. By understanding the complexity of women's mental health, we can collaborate to encourage their well-being and create a more equitable society for all.
The Intersection of Web Information and Women's Emotional State
Exploring the complex relationship between women's mental health and their interaction with online information is crucial in today's digital age. While W3 information can provide numerous benefits, such as access to support groups and valuable resources, it can also contribute to feelings of anxiety. The constant exposure to idealized images and societal expectations can negatively impact self-esteem and body image, particularly for young women. Furthermore, cyberbullying and online harassment pose serious threats to women's well-being, leading to increased levels of sadness. It is essential to promote a more healthy online environment that prioritizes the mental health of women.
